Jaspers drop three to rival Rams in volleyball match
The Manhattan Jaspers women's volleyball team suffered a loss when it hosted Fordham University Wednesday.
The Fordham Rams took an early lead in the first game and went on to win 30-26, despite a late rally from the Jaspers. The Jaspers and Rams fought for the lead in game two, but Fordham broke away to claim a 30-22 victory. The Rams went on to sweep the match, squashing the Jaspers 30-21 in game three.
Fordham was led by coach Pete Volkert, who formerly led the Manhattan team for seven years.
Next, the Rams will host their seventh annual Rose Hill Classic this weekend.
